I need a clean, working GlobalProtect remote-access VPN on my Palo Alto Networks PA-3260. The plan is simple:
• Local database authentication with standard username/password logins—no external Radius or LDAP.
• Split-tunnel design so only traffic destined for our corporate subnets crosses the tunnel; all other internet traffic stays local to the user.
• Two static 1:1 NAT rules for internal servers, complete with the matching security and U-Turn policies.
You’ll build the portal and gateway, set the appropriate agent configurations, create the local user accounts, specify the split-tunnel include routes, and test from a Windows or macOS GlobalProtect client. Once that works, we’ll verify inbound and outbound reachability for the NATed servers.
Acceptance criteria
1. I can sign in through GlobalProtect with a local user and reach internal resources while internet traffic breaks out locally.
2. Each internal server is reachable externally on its new public IP, and it can initiate outbound sessions without issues.
I can give you GUI or CLI access in a shared session, or you can supply step-by-step commands for me to paste. A brief hand-over document so I can reproduce the setup in the future will wrap things up.
